Even if you're licensed, brandishing a handgun is a BAD idea... Instead of the bad guy, YOU may end up with a cop's size 10 boot on your neck shoving your face in the pavement.

Ladies... Windows up, doors locked.

True story... A lady puts her shopping bags in the trunk, closes it, gets in the car and starts it... A decent looking man comes up and smiles, (her window is up, door locked) He yells, "Ma'am, your trunk is open!" smiles, and walks away. She opens the door, walks to the trunk... He runs back, jumps in the car, and away he goes with your car/house keys/purse, and all the goody's you just bought.

If your concern is carjacking, you ought to check out some of the special training available for firearms and other defense techniques. You'd be surprised how hard it actually can be to access your firearm and fire across your chest inside a confined space. And lefties can be pinned in by accident (the criminal leans into or grabs the left arm to control you and most people haven't trained to use their off hand). Typically half the people who haven't trained to use their off hand to fire a weapon simply won't grab their weapon with their off hand if their main is unusable in a panic situation (no joke).

If guns in your car make you nervous, consider a real high quality taser that uses cartridges.
